Window remodeling services involve upgrading or replacing existing windows to improve the appearance, functionality, and energy efficiency of a property. These services typically include removing outdated or damaged windows and installing modern, more durable options that better suit the style and needs of the building. Contractors may also offer customization options such as different frame materials, glass types, and hardware to match the property's aesthetic and performance goals. The process aims to enhance the overall look of a property while providing improved insulation, noise reduction, and security features.

One of the primary issues addressed by window remodeling is energy loss. Older windows often have poor seals or single-pane glass that can lead to increased heating and cooling costs. Remodeling services help solve these problems by replacing inefficient windows with energy-efficient models that provide better insulation. Additionally, window upgrades can help mitigate issues like drafts, condensation, and difficulty operating windows, which can be common in aging or damaged units. These improvements contribute to a more comfortable indoor environment and can reduce long-term utility expenses.

Contractors offering window remodeling services can provide a variety of window styles to suit different property requirements. Common options include double-hung, casement, sliding, and picture windows, each offering distinct benefits in terms of ventilation, ease of operation, and design. The selection process often considers factors such as the property's architectural style, energy efficiency goals, and budget constraints. The overview below groups typical Window Remodeling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Milford, MI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Window Replacement Costs - Typically, replacing a standard window can range from $300 to $1,000 per window, depending on size and material choices. Larger or custom windows may cost more, with prices reaching up to $2,000 each in some cases.

Labor and Installation Fees - Installation costs usually account for 50% to 60% of the total project price. In Milford, MI, labor fees for window remodeling can range from $150 to $500 per window, depending on complexity and contractor rates.

Material Expenses - The cost of window materials varies widely, with vinyl options starting around $200 per window and premium wood or fiberglass models reaching $1,500 or more. Material choice impacts both the initial investment and long-term maintenance costs.

Additional Costs - Extra expenses may include window framing, insulation, and any necessary structural modifications, which can add $100 to $400 per window. These costs depend on the existing window setup and specific remodeling requirements.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
